Abstract

Systems, devices, and techniques are provided for occupancy assessment of a vehicle. For one or more occupants of the vehicle, the occupancy assessment establishes position and/or identity for some or all of the occupant(s).

What is claimed is: 
     
         1 . A system, comprising:
 interface circuitry to provide first data representing visual information and second data representing aural information of an occupant of an automobile; and   a computing device to receive the first data and the second data,
 comprising one or more processors, and 
 memory to store computer readable instructions that, when executed by the one or more processors, cause the system to
 process, from the first data, facial image information of the occupant of the automobile, 
 process, from the second data, voice information of the occupant of the automobile, and 
 enable one or more operations of the automobile in accordance with the facial image information, the voice information, or both the facial image information and voice information of the occupant of the automobile. 
 
   
     
     
         2 . The system of  claim 1 , further comprising:
 one or more cameras to capture the visual information of the occupant of the automobile; and   one or more microphones to capture the aural information of the occupant of the automobile.   
     
     
         3 . The system of  claim 2 , further comprising one or more antennas to enable one or more wireless communication links between the interface circuitry and the one or more cameras and the one or more microphones via which to provide the first data, the second data, or both the first data and second data. 
     
     
         4 . The system of  claim 1 , wherein the occupant of the automobile comprises a passenger of the automobile.
